When travelling from Leatherhead station, passengers can take advantage of a fully-staffed ticket office, open from early morning until late in the evening throughout the week, including weekends. For those who prefer using machines, there are accessible options available, ensuring that purchasing or collecting tickets is never an issue. The station offers smartcard issuance and validation for those using digital tickets, making ticketing a swift process.
Passenger needs for assistance are well-catered with designated help points and staff available at specific times to aid travelers. CCTV is installed for enhanced security, ensuring peace of mind. While there’s no waiting room or luggage storage available, passengers can relax on platform seating. For drivers, the station provides ample parking spaces, including accessible bays, all under the vigilant eye of CCTV.
Although the Leatherhead train station has partial step-free access, assistance is available for those with reduced mobility. A staff-operated ramp is present to facilitate platform-train access, and wheelchair accessibility is ensured across platforms. Despite the lack of accessible toilets and certain conveniences like baby-changing stations, the station remains dedicated to supporting passengers with helpful staff to respond to assistance requests efficiently.

Despite its unassuming nature, Heworth Station provides some basic amenities. There is no manned ticket office, but passengers can easily buy and collect pre-purchased tickets using the available ticket machines, which are fully accessible. The station is categorized as a Category B Station, meaning that while it is unstaffed, it has ramped access to platforms, ensuring wheelchair users and those with mobility impairments can navigate without issues. However, do note that facilities like toilets, waiting rooms, refreshment services, and bicycle storage are lacking, perhaps making it more of a transit point than a hangout location.
Though CCTV is not present, there are customer help points scattered throughout the station to ensure assistance is just a call away, offering a sense of security and support to travelers. For those seeking additional help, the conductor on the arriving train is available to assist with boarding and disembarking needs.
